Opened 2 years ago

Last modified 14 months ago

#21839 assigned defect

"Amazon.in (partial)" is partially broken

Reported by: cypherpunks Owned by: legind
Priority: Medium Milestone:
Component: HTTPS Everywhere/EFF-HTTPS Everywhere Version:
Severity: Normal Keywords:
Cc: Actual Points:
Parent ID: Points:
Reviewer: Sponsor:

Description

Example page:- http://www.amazon.in/dp/B00W0VBOH0/ref=twister_dp_update?_encoding=UTF8&psc=1

When trying to select sizes or colors, the page fails to update with https everywhere enabled on firefox.

This is due to this xhr request being clobbered by jquery/cors.

For some reason the request method switches to OPTIONS instead of GET when the below xhr request is upgraded from http to https.

https://www.amazon.in/gp/twister/ajaxv2?sid=

The amazon server responds with a 405 for an OPTIONS request.

Need to add this exclusion pattern.

<exclusion pattern="www.amazon.in/gp/twister/ajaxv2*" />

Child Tickets

Change History (1)

comment:1 Changed 14 months ago by teor

Owner: changed from jsha to legind
Status: newassigned

Make legind the owner of all HTTPS Everywhere tickets that were mistakenly assigned to jsha.
(See #26397.)

Note: See TracTickets for help on using tickets.